Canine Therapy Techniques: How it Works & Benefits
Canine therapy, also known as animal-assisted therapy, is a developing field leveraging the unique bond between humans and hounds to achieve therapeutic goals. It's not simply petting a canine; it’s a structured intervention guided by a trained practitioner and involving specially selected and trained animals. The process typically involves gentle interaction, such as playing with the animal, guided games, or simply being in quiet companionship. These sessions are customized to address specific needs, such as alleviating anxiety, improving motor skills, and improving social interaction. The advantages are diverse, ranging from lowered blood pressure and decreased feelings of loneliness to increased self-esteem and a more positive outlook. This type of intervention is particularly helpful for individuals facing challenges related to psychological distress, physical limitations, or memory loss. A crucial element is the handler’s expertise in interpreting the animal’s signals and ensuring a safe and positive experience for everyone involved.

Canine Therapy for Distress: Finding Comfort & Relationship
For individuals grappling with the lingering effects of past experiences, traditional therapeutic approaches aren’t always effective. Increasingly, hound therapy is emerging as a valuable additional method, offering a unique pathway to healing. This particular form of therapy utilizes the innate reassuring presence and unconditional love of dogs to facilitate emotional regulation, reduce anxiety, and foster a sense of safety. The gentle weight of a dog resting on a lap, the rhythm of a tail wag, or the simple act of petting can trigger the release of relaxing hormones, counteracting the physiological responses often associated with adverse memories. It's not just about companionship; trained professionals carefully guide interactions, utilizing the dog's behavior to promote empowerment and build coping skills, providing a non-judgmental environment to process painful emotions. Ultimately, hound therapy strives to help individuals reconnect with themselves and the world around them, fostering resilience and hope for a brighter future.
